							- #!/usr/bin/env bash
 
- # -*- coding: utf-8; mode: sh indent-tabs-mode: nil -*-
 
- # SPDX-License-Identifier: AGPL-3.0-or-later
 
- #
 
- # Tools to build and install redis [1] binaries & packages.
 
- #
 
- # [1] https://redis.io/download#installation
 
- #
 
- # 1. redis.devpkg (sudo)
 
- # 2. redis.build
 
- # 3. redis.install (sudo)
 
- #
 
- # systemd commands::
 
- #
 
- #    sudo -H systemctl status searxng-redis
 
- #    sudo -H journalctl -u searxng-redis
 
- #    sudo -H journalctl --vacuum-size=1M
 
- #
 
- # Test socket connection from client (local user)::
 
- #
 
- #    $ sudo -H ./manage redis.addgrp "${USER}"
 
- #    # logout & login to get member of group
 
- #    $ groups
 
- #    ... searxng-redis ...
 
- #    $ source /usr/local/searxng-redis/.redis_env
 
- #    $ which redis-cli
 
- #    /usr/local/searxng-redis/.local/bin/redis-cli
 
- #
 
- #    $ redis-cli -s /usr/local/searxng-redis/redis.sock
 
- #    redis /usr/local/searxng-redis/redis.sock> set foo bar
 
- #    OK
 
- #    redis /usr/local/searxng-redis/redis.sock> get foo
 
- #    "bar"
 
- #    [CTRL-D]
 
- # shellcheck disable=SC2091
 
- # shellcheck source=utils/lib.sh
 
- . /dev/null
 
- REDIS_GIT_URL="https://github.com/redis/redis.git"
 
- REDIS_GIT_TAG="${REDIS_GIT_TAG:-6.2.6}"
 
- REDIS_USER="searxng-redis"
 
- REDIS_HOME="/usr/local/${REDIS_USER}"
 
- REDIS_HOME_BIN="${REDIS_HOME}/.local/bin"
 
- REDIS_ENV="${REDIS_HOME}/.redis_env"
 
- REDIS_SERVICE_NAME="searxng-redis"
 
- REDIS_SYSTEMD_UNIT="${SYSTEMD_UNITS}/${REDIS_SERVICE_NAME}.service"
 
- # binaries to compile & install
 
- REDIS_INSTALL_EXE=(redis-server redis-benchmark redis-cli)
 
- # link names of redis-server binary
 
- REDIS_LINK_EXE=(redis-sentinel redis-check-rdb redis-check-aof)
 
- REDIS_CONF="${REDIS_HOME}/redis.conf"
 
- REDIS_CONF_TEMPLATE=$(cat <<EOF
 
- # Note that in order to read the configuration file, Redis must be
 
- # started with the file path as first argument:
 
- #
 
- # ./redis-server /path/to/redis.conf
 
- # bind 127.0.0.1 -::1
 
- protected-mode yes
 
- # Accept connections on the specified port, default is 6379 (IANA #815344).
 
- # If port 0 is specified Redis will not listen on a TCP socket.
 
- port 0
 
- # Specify the path for the Unix socket that will be used to listen for
 
- # incoming connections.
 
- unixsocket ${REDIS_HOME}/run/redis.sock
 
- unixsocketperm 770
 
- # The working directory.
 
- dir ${REDIS_HOME}/run
 
- # If you run Redis from upstart or systemd, Redis can interact with your
 
- # supervision tree.
 
- supervised auto
 
- pidfile ${REDIS_HOME}/run/redis.pid
 
- # log to the system logger
 
- syslog-enabled yes
 
- EOF
 
- )
